What Tokenization Actually Means (Without the Buzzwords)
Tokenization is the act of representing a real-world right, asset, or claim as an entry on a programmable ledger. That ledger can be public (Ethereum, Solana, Avalanche), permissioned (Hyperledger, Corda), or hybrid.
Once an asset is represented this way, three things become possible that were not before:
- Programmable transfer. Ownership changes happen via code — instantly, 24/7, with rules baked in (KYC checks, transfer restrictions, vesting).
- Composability. A token can be collateral in one application, an input to another, and a payment instrument in a third — without bilateral integrations.
- Auditable history. Every transfer, every state change, every authorization is recorded and verifiable, forever.
That is the whole technology in three sentences. Everything else is implementation detail.
Where It Genuinely Pays Off
Most tokenization use cases that survive contact with reality fall into one of four categories. These are the ones we recommend pursuing for serious businesses today.
1. Invoice and trade finance
A small business with a $500k invoice from a creditworthy customer waits 60–90 days to get paid. Factoring solves this — at usurious rates, with friction, and limited to suppliers who clear minimum size.
Tokenizing the invoice as a transferable, verifiable digital asset lets a much wider pool of capital fund it. The tooling is mature: platforms like Centrifuge and others have moved billions of dollars of real invoices on-chain. For SMBs, this is access to working capital that was previously gated. For investors, it is yield uncorrelated with crypto.
If your business waits on receivables, this is the most immediately useful tokenization play of the next two years.
2. Supply-chain provenance
Industries where origin matters — high-value foods, pharmaceuticals, fashion, art, electronics, regulated commodities — are converging on token-based provenance. Each step in the supply chain (farm, processor, shipper, retailer) records to a shared ledger, and the consumer (or auditor) can verify the chain end to end.
This is not theoretical. Major coffee chains, several luxury houses, and most of the top diamond producers now use token-based provenance in production. The driver is not "crypto" — it is anti-counterfeiting, sustainability claims, and ESG compliance, all of which used to require expensive third-party audits and now require a QR scan.
3. Loyalty and customer ownership
Traditional loyalty programs are a closed system. The points expire, they do not transfer between brands, and they sit on the company's balance sheet as a liability. Tokenized loyalty inverts this: points are owned by the customer, transferable, and composable with partner programs.
Airlines, hotel chains, and several large retailers have launched tokenized loyalty pilots — not as a marketing stunt, but because interoperability drives engagement. A customer who can swap your points for partner points uses your program more, not less. The unit economics are better than legacy loyalty.
The catch: it requires a clear regulatory path (most jurisdictions treat loyalty tokens as utility, but check) and a UX that hides every word like "wallet" and "blockchain."
4. Real-world assets (RWAs) — bonds, funds, and credit
This is the heaviest hitter and the most institutional. Tokenizing money-market funds, treasuries, and private credit lets these assets be delivered to investors 24/7, with same-second settlement, and used as collateral in adjacent products. The largest asset managers in the world have launched tokenized funds, and the volumes are growing fast.
For an SMB or mid-market business, the relevant angle is usually as a buyer or integrator — embedding tokenized treasury yield into your idle cash management, for example, instead of letting it sit at zero in a checking account. The plumbing for this is now production-grade.
Where It Is Still Mostly Hype
Equally important: the use cases that are still being aggressively marketed but rarely make sense yet.
- Tokenized real estate for retail investors. Regulatory friction, valuation challenges, and shallow secondary markets keep this in pilot phase. Nice idea, not yet a working business model in most jurisdictions.
- Fully on-chain corporate equity. Possible in a few jurisdictions, mostly impractical. Cap-table SaaS solves the same problems with less friction.
- NFT-based "membership" for products that have no community. If your business is not natively community-driven, NFTs are an expensive way to build a Discord channel.
- Tokens for the sake of tokens. If the answer to "why is this on-chain?" is not immediately obvious to a skeptical CFO, it should not be on-chain.
A useful test: if removing the token from the architecture would not materially worsen the business outcome, you do not need a token.
The Questions to Ask Before You Build
If a use case from the "actually pays off" list resonates, here is the diligence we run before recommending implementation.
Regulatory
- What jurisdiction does the asset live in, and what is the legal characterization (security, utility, payment instrument, e-money)?
- Who are the buyers — accredited, retail, institutional? Different rules apply.
- Is there a recognized framework (MiCA in the EU, MAS in Singapore, FCA's regime in the UK) you can map to, or are you trying to invent the path?
- What licensing do you need vs. partnering with a regulated provider?
If you cannot answer these in week one, the project is not yet ready to scope.
Chain selection
- Public, permissioned, or hybrid? Public chains are cheaper and more composable; permissioned chains are easier to sell to compliance.
- Throughput and finality requirements? A high-volume loyalty program has different needs than a quarterly bond settlement.
- Custody model? Self-custody, qualified custodian, or hybrid? This is usually the longest single line item in legal review.
Integration
- What systems does this need to talk to? ERP, CRM, treasury, KYC provider, identity provider?
- Does the user-facing product need a wallet, or can wallets be abstracted away with account abstraction or custodial accounts?
- What is your off-ramp — how do tokens become fiat, and on what timeline?
Operational
- Who runs the on-chain operations day-to-day? Treasury? Engineering? A new function?
- What is the incident response plan for a smart-contract bug, an oracle failure, or a chain-level event?
- How do you handle compliance reporting (transaction monitoring, sanctions screening) on-chain?
These questions are unglamorous. They are also where most stalled tokenization projects went wrong.
A Pragmatic Path
For an SMB or mid-market business considering its first tokenization initiative, the path that consistently works:
- Pick one use case from the "actually pays off" list. Not three. One.
- Find a regulated counterparty already operating in that space. Building the regulatory rails yourself is for protocol companies, not application companies.
- Run a closed pilot. A handful of customers, a small AUM cap, six months of operation.
- Measure the unit economics against the legacy alternative you are replacing. If it is not 2x better on at least one dimension, kill it.
- Decide whether to scale, partner, or shelve with real data.
Most of the value in tokenization for non-crypto businesses comes from using it like infrastructure — like you use payment rails or cloud — not from inventing the rails yourself.
A Word on Smart-Contract Risk
Whatever you tokenize, the smart contracts underneath are now part of your operational risk surface. Use audited, battle-tested standards (ERC-20 for fungible, ERC-1400 for security tokens, ERC-721/1155 for unique). Conclusion
Tokenization is no longer a question of whether it will be useful for traditional businesses. It already is, in narrow but high-value places. The question is whether the specific opportunity in front of you is one of those places — or one of the many that still sound exciting in a deck and look thin under operational scrutiny.
The discipline is the same as any other technology decision: clear problem, clear unit economics, clear regulatory path, and a willingness to stop if any of the three falls apart.
